Abstract
In this paper, we study the CFT duals for extreme black holes in the stretched horizon formalism. We consider the extremal RN, Kerr–Newman–AdS–dS, as well as the higher dimensional Kerr–AdS–dS black holes. In all these cases, we reproduce the well-established CFT duals. Actually we show that for stationary extreme black holes, the stretched horizon formalism always gives rise to the same dual CFT pictures as the ones suggested by ASG of corresponding near horizon geometries. Furthermore, we propose new CFT duals for 4D Kerr–Newman–AdS–dS and higher dimensional Kerr–AdS–dS black holes. We find that every dual CFT is defined with respect to a rotation in certain angular direction, along which the translation defines a image Killing symmetry. In the presence of two sets of image symmetry, the novel CFT duals are generated by the modular group image, and for n sets of image symmetry there are general CFT duals generated by T-duality group image.
